Loan Options and Strategies to Manage Student Debt
Federal Student Loans
Federal student loans are often the first choice for many students due to their favorable terms. For undergraduate students pursuing a computer engineering degree at Boise State University, options include Direct Subsidized Loans and Direct Unsubsidized Loans. These loans typically feature lower interest rates and flexible repayment plans. To access these, students must complete the Free Application for Federal Student Aid (FAFSA).
Private Student Loans
Private lenders, such as banks or credit unions, offer student loans that can cover additional costs not met by federal aid. These loans often have higher interest rates and less flexible repayment options. It is advisable to consider private loans only after exhausting federal aid options, and to compare terms carefully before borrowing.
Loan Repayment Strategies
Effective management of student debt involves understanding repayment plans. Federal loans offer options such as Income-Driven Repayment (IDR), which adjusts payments based on income, and Public Service Loan Forgiveness (PSLF) for those working in qualifying public service roles. Graduates should prioritize early repayment when possible, and consider refinancing options to secure lower interest rates post-graduation.
Financial Planning Tips
Creating a detailed budget that accounts for tuition, living expenses, and loan repayment is essential. Students should also explore scholarships, work-study programs, and part-time employment opportunities to reduce reliance on loans. Keeping track of borrowing limits and understanding the total debt load helps prevent over-borrowing and facilitates responsible financial planning.
Program Overview and What Students Will Study
Curriculum Highlights
The Computer Engineering program at Boise State University combines principles of electrical engineering and computer science. Students will study core topics such as digital logic design, computer architecture, embedded systems, programming languages, and software development. Advanced coursework may include network security, robotics, and VLSI design.
Hands-On Learning and Projects
The program emphasizes experiential learning through labs, capstone projects, and internships. Students gain practical skills in designing and implementing hardware and software systems, preparing them for real-world challenges in the tech industry.
Skills Developed
Graduates will develop critical thinking, problem-solving, programming, and hardware design skills. They will also learn about ethical considerations and the societal impact of technology, fostering well-rounded professionals ready to innovate and adapt.
Career Opportunities and Job Prospects
Employment Sectors
Computer engineering graduates can pursue careers in numerous industries, including technology, telecommunications, aerospace, automotive, healthcare, and government agencies. Opportunities range from hardware design and embedded systems development to software engineering and cybersecurity.
Job Titles and Salary Expectations
Potential roles include Computer Hardware Engineer, Systems Software Developer, Network Architect, Embedded Systems Engineer, and Cybersecurity Analyst. According to industry data, starting salaries for computer engineers typically range from $70,000 to $90,000 annually, with experienced professionals earning significantly more.
Career Growth and Advancement
The tech industry is known for rapid innovation and demand for skilled professionals. Graduates can advance into management roles, specialized technical positions, or pursue further education such as a master's or Ph.D. to enhance their career prospects.

Financial Information: Tuition, Debt, and ROI
Tuition Costs
At Boise State University, in-state students pay approximately $8,782 annually for the computer engineering program, while out-of-state students are charged about $26,976. These costs are competitive compared to other institutions and are complemented by financial aid options.
Estimating Student Debt
Since the median student debt for this program is not specified, it is prudent for students to plan conservatively. Borrowing only what is necessary and exploring scholarships can significantly reduce debt burdens.
Return on Investment (ROI)
Given the robust job market and high earning potential in computer engineering, the ROI for this degree is generally favorable. Graduates often recover their educational investment within a few years post-graduation, especially when employed in high-demand sectors.
